Troubleshooting Common Issues with Vertical Packaging Machines: A Comprehensive Guide

In the realm of automated packaging, vertical packaging machines (VPMs) reign supreme. However, like any intricate machine, they are prone to occasional glitches that can disrupt productivity and cause headaches for operators. This guide will equip you with invaluable knowledge to diagnose and resolve common VPM issues, ensuring seamless packaging operations.

Mechanical Maladies

– Film jamming: Check the tension and alignment of the packaging film. Ensure there are no creases or wrinkles that could hinder its movement.

– Servo system malfunction: Monitor the performance of the servo motors responsible for precise package sealing. Faulty wiring or incorrect settings can cause errors.

– Conveyor malfunction: Ensure the conveyor belt is running smoothly and that packages are being fed correctly into the machine.

Electrical Hiccups

– Power fluctuations: Voltage spikes or drops can disrupt the machine’s operations. Install a voltage regulator to stabilize the power supply.

– Sensor issues: Photoelectric sensors are crucial for detecting products and triggering sealing operations. Check for any blockages, misalignments, or faulty wiring.

– PLC malfunction: The programmable logic controller (PLC) is the brain of the VPM. Diagnose any software or hardware problems and update the PLC’s firmware as needed.

Environmental Challenges

– Excessive moisture: High humidity can cause condensation, which can interfere with electrical components. Use dehumidifiers or air conditioning to control humidity levels.

– Dirt and dust: Contaminants can accumulate on sensors, conveyor belts, and other moving parts. Clean the machine regularly to prevent malfunctions.

– Temperature extremes: Extreme temperatures can affect the performance of electronic components. Ensure the operating environment is within the specified temperature range.

Preventative Measures

To avoid costly downtime, proactive maintenance is essential:

– Regularly inspect and clean the machine, paying attention to critical components.

– Perform preventative maintenance tasks, such as lubrication and firmware updates.

– Train operators on proper operation and troubleshooting techniques.

– Keep a supply of common spare parts on hand for quick replacements.
